Summary: On this episode of the Christopher Scott Talk Show Podcast: “The link between marijuana and violence doesn’t appear limited to people with preexisting psychosis. Researchers have studied alcohol and violence for generations, proving that alcohol is a risk factor for domestic abuse, assault, and even murder. Far less work has been done on marijuana, in part because advocates have stigmatized anyone who raises the issue. But studies showing that marijuana use is a significant risk factor for violence have quietly piled up. Many of them weren’t even designed to catch the link, but they did. Dozens of such studies exist, covering everything from bullying by high school students to fighting among vacationers in Spain.” – Hillsdale College This is a fascinating discussion based on an article by Alex Berenson, Author, Tell Your Children: The Truth About Marijuana, Mental Illness, and Violence.
